๐Ÿ‡บ๐Ÿ‡ธ President Trump has just formed the 'Shield of Americas' coalition - an initiative with Latin America countries to DESTROY the narco-terrorists and drug cartels in our hemisphere.

Trump hosted the Shield of the Americas summit, where leaders signed a charter affirming the right to chart their own destinies free from interference. The summit was part of a broader effort to strengthen regional security cooperation and aimed at shoring up support for the administrationโ€™s anti-drug trafficking operations.

โ€œEvery leader here today is united in the conviction that we cannot and will not tolerate the lawlessness in our hemisphere any longer,โ€ Trump said. โ€œThe only way to defeat these enemies is by unleashing the power of our militaries. We have to use our military, you have to use your militaries.โ€

๐Ÿค– OpenAIโ€™s head of robotics resigns over companyโ€™s Pentagon deal

The head of OpenAIโ€™s robotics team resigned Saturday, citing the companyโ€™s deal to deploy its AI models within the Pentagonโ€™s classified network as the cause. OpenAI confirmed Caitlin Kalinowskiโ€™s departure in an email statement and said it believes the agreement with the Defense Department โ€œcreates a workable path for responsible national security uses of AI while making clear our red lines, no domestic surveillance and no autonomous weapons.โ€

โ€œWe recognize that people have strong views about these issues and we will continue to engage in discussion with employees, government, civil society and communities around the world,โ€ - the company said.

๐ŸŽฎ Linux hacked onto a PS5 to turn Sony's console into a Steam Machine

In light of Sony's heavily-rumored decision to pivot away from PC releases, one security engineer took matters into his own hands and turned the PS5 into a PC. Andy Nguyen ported Linux to a PlayStation 5 console, hacking through several layers of hardware and software barriers thanks to full-chain exploits. Not only did he manage to get Linux running, but the modded console actually performs well in games.

Now that it's a PC, it can do anything a standard computer can, which includes running GTA V Enhanced Edition via Steam. It's set to 1440p resolution, with ray tracing enabled as denoted by the "High RT" preset in settings. The gameplay is steady at a smooth 60 FPS with barely any fluctuation, and even the sound is working. But the PS5 Slim doesn't have the thermal headroom to keep up with those numbers and simply overheats if pushed any harder. To achieve this, Andy used a PS5 running significantly older firmware, between 1.0 and 2.0, that was released around five years ago.

In a way, this is a tease of what the upcoming Steam Machine will be since it'll feature similar performance and run SteamOS, based on Linux. Through Proton, it can play pretty much any Windows game, sometimes with even a slight FPS bump.

โšก๏ธ A dark sky loomed over Iran after Israel's strikes on Tehran's oil facilities. Black snow fell there in the morning.

After the fire, a large amount of combustion products entered the atmosphere. They react with moisture in the air and form acids that fall with the rain.

The Red Crescent warned that acid rain is expected soon in Iran, as the explosion of such facilities leads to the release of toxic compounds into the atmosphere. It posing risks of chemical burns to the skin and severe lung damage.

๐Ÿ‡บ๐Ÿ‡ธ US customs agency expects tariff refund system to be ready in 45 days

The U.S. customs agency is readying a system within 45 days to process refunds of returning $166 billion in tariff payments to around 330,000 importers. The U.S. Supreme Court did not say how the collected tariffs should be refunded, leaving small importers worried the process would be expensive and time-consuming.

"This new process will require minimal submission from importers," - Lord said in his declaration, filed with the U.S. Court of International Trade as government lawyers began meeting with Judge Richard Eaton from the court.


Judge Richard Eaton said in his Wednesday order that he had been appointed by the trade court to hear the roughly 2,000 lawsuits filed by importers including FedEx and L'Oreal seeking refunds. Trade lawyers said those lawsuits were the tip of the iceberg, and thousands more were prepared to sue if the government failed to develop a system for automatic refunds. Affiliates of Nintendo and CVS became the latest large companies to sue for refunds.

๐Ÿ‡จ๐Ÿ‡ญSwiss put cash into constitution to guard against its demise

Switzerland voted to enshrine the availability of cash in its constitution, assenting to a push designed to guard against the demise of physical money. A government plan for the legal change has 69% backing, according to preliminary official estimates on Sunday.

The vote marks a rare moment of circumspection on the nature of money. Cash use for payments has rapidly declined dropping to just 30% of transactions two years ago, from 70% less than a decade before. Even so, the Swiss are fond of their francs, and still use coins with designs dating back to the mid-19th century. ๐Ÿ˜„

๐Ÿ‡ฏ๐Ÿ‡ฒ๐Ÿ‡จ๐Ÿ‡บ Jamaica to end decades-long agreement with Cuba over medical missions criticized by US

Jamaicaโ€™s foreign ministry said that the decades-old arrangement involving Cuban medical missions would not be renewed after both governments failed to reach agreement on new terms for a technical cooperation pact. The previous agreement had already expired in February 2023, and negotiations over a replacement arrangement were unsuccessful.

As recently as last year, officials noted that more than 400 Cuban doctors, nurses, biomedical engineers, and technicians were working across the country, filling critical gaps in public health services. US Secretary of State Marco Rubio has described the initiative as a form of โ€œforced laborโ€ and human trafficking, arguing that the Cuban government retains a large portion of the salaries paid to doctors working abroad.

๐ŸŽฎ Microsoft patents system for AI helpers to finish games for you

Microsoft published a patent application called โ€œState management for video game help sessionsโ€, designed for players who might be stuck in a video game. The filing described a cloud-based system that offered help without forcing players to tab out, Google a guide, or scrub YouTube.

The core idea is simple: the game would offer a โ€œcloud-based help sessionโ€ during play, pull a โ€œhelp session starting stateโ€ from your save, then stream the session to a helperโ€™s device while the helper sent inputs back. After the assist, the system could โ€œprovide the updated help session state to the current gaming session.โ€ In plain English: you ask for help, someone else runs the tricky stretch, and you get the game back in a better spot.

It's not too dissimilar from the Copilot AI already available in the Xbox app. The patent discusses the need to accurately track who was playing when an achievement is unlocked, and also to ensure human helpers are paired with players in the same age range โ€” so you don't have a scenario where a child is able to jump in and help slice up zombies in Resident Evil Requiem, for example. ๐Ÿ˜„

๐Ÿ›ฉ Flexjet has completed installation of Starlink across its large cabin fleet

FlexJet, the second-largest private jet operator, has announced that it has now installed Starlink high-speed internet across its entire large-cabin fleet of 60 aircraft, delivering seamless, reliable connectivity from boarding to touchdown. Its large cabin fleet includes the Gulfstream G700, G650, and G450. Flexjet expects to complete fleetwide installation by the end of 2027.

๐Ÿ‡ฆ๐Ÿ‡บ Australia weighing requests for assistance from countries attacked by Iran

Australia's government said on Sunday it was considering requests to help protect countries attacked by Iran in the widening Middle East conflict, but reiterated it would โ€Œnot take part in any military operations in Iran.

"We've had many countries, which are non participants, (that) have been attacked by Iran through this. You would anticipate as a consequence that we have been asked for assistance, and we will work โ through that carefully," - Foreign Minister Penny Wong said in televised remarks.


Australia, a close U.S. ally, has said it will not deploy troops to the Middle East if the conflict escalates. Asked if Australia could help protect nations from Iranian drone and missile attacks, Wong said "correct". Now Australia is currently working with airlines to help thousands of Australians stranded in the Middle East.

๐Ÿ†• US startup plans to build data centers inside ocean-based wind turbines, servers water cooled via chilly North Sea

San Francisco-based startup Aikido Technologies, which is focused on building offshore wind turbines, is experimenting with adding data centers to its power platforms. The company plans to launch a 100-kilowatt unit that combines a wind turbine with an AI server off the coast of Norway in the North Sea by the end of 2026.

Aikido is using a semi-submersible design for its offshore wind turbines, similar to what many oil and gas companies use when drilling in high seas. This design comes with three ballast-filled legs, filled with fresh water to help maintain buoyancy and stay upright. From there, itโ€™s secured to the seabed via chains and anchors, ensuring that it will remain in the general area, even as the wind and ocean batter it.

The firm says that it can add up to a 3- to 4-MW data hall in the upper part of each leg, meaning each wind turbine can potentially become a 9- to 12-MW data center. Experiments like this can potentially solve the power and space problems that most land-based data centers face at the moment.

๐Ÿค– Alibaba-linked AI agent hijacked GPUs for unauthorized crypto mining

An autonomous AI agent called ROME, built by Alibaba-affiliated research teams, spontaneously attempted to mine cryptocurrency and open covert network tunnels during training, with no human instruction to do so, researchers said. The agent established a reverse SSH tunnel to an external server and diverted GPU resources away from its training workload toward crypto mining.

The researchers chalked up the behaviors to "instrumental side effects of autonomous tool use under RL optimization," meaning the agent, while trying to optimize for its training objective, apparently decided on its own that acquiring additional computing resources and financial capacity would help it complete its tasks. The incident adds to a growing list of autonomous AI agents behaving in unintended ways.

๐Ÿ›ข๐Ÿ“ˆ Oil bounds above $100 a barrel, Brent climbs 27%

WTI crude oil futures soared as much as 31% on Monday, before easing back to trade 25% higher around $113 per barrel, amid a series of production cuts from major Middle Eastern producers following disruptions in the Strait of Hormuz. The spike marks the largest one-day gain since April 2020 and the highest price level since June 2022, building on last weekโ€™s 35.6% rally.

Brent crude soared 27% to $117.58 a barrel, the biggest daily gain since at least 1988, which came on top of a 28% rise last week.

โšก๏ธ The G7 will hold an emergency meeting today to discuss coordinating the release of strategic petroleum reserves to stabilize oil prices

G7 finance ministers and International Energy Agency (IEA) Executive Director Fatih Birol will hold a teleconference at 8:30 AM (NY) to discuss the possibility of jointly releasing emergency oil reserves under the coordination of the IEA. Three G7 countries, including the US, have so far expressed support for this idea.

The 32 member countries of the IEA hold strategic reserves, part of a collective emergency system established to address the oil price crisis. US officials believe a joint release of 300 to 400 million barrels of oil reserves would be appropriate, equivalent to 25% to 30% of the total reserves of 1.2 billion barrels.

Donald Trump also commented on the rise in oil prices in the post on Truth Social.

๐Ÿ‡บ๐Ÿ‡ธ๐Ÿ‡ฏ๐Ÿ‡ต US, Japan may partner with Japan Display for new US plant under investment package

Tokyo and Washington are looking at building a display factory in the U.S. in partnership with Japan Display as part of Japan's planned $550 billion investment package. The plan is aimed at strengthening U.S. display manufacturing amid Washington's concerns over reliance on China for display technologies used in military systems at a time when fierce price competition has pushed most Japanese manufacturers out of the market.

The project is expected to be worth roughly $13 billion. Japan Display, formed in 2012 in a government-backed merger of the display units of Sony Group, Toshiba and Hitachi, was once one of the world's top vendors of liquid crystal display (LCD) panels and the primary screen supplier for Apple's iPhones.

๐Ÿ’Š A tiny wireless eye implant may help restore some of that lost central vision

In a clinical study, many blind older adults who received the implant regained enough clarity to recognize letters and short words. Dr. Jose-Alain Sahel at the University of Pittsburgh reported meaningful improvements in 26 of the 32 participants who completed follow-up testing.

The device targets age-related macular degeneration, an eye disease that damages the center of the retina. The result is a permanent blank spot in the center of vision. The PRIMA implant, about 0.08 inches wide (2 millimeters), attempts to solve that problem by replacing the lost light sensors with a tiny electronic chip. Electrical signals stimulate nearby retinal neurons, which then send visual information through the optic nerve to the brain.

Future studies will need to track whether the visual signal remains stable for years and how continuing retinal degeneration might affect performance.

๐Ÿ‡บ๐Ÿ‡ธ Trumpโ€™s National Cyber Strategy pledges to support crypto and blockchain

The White House has released a new cyber strategy document titled 'President Trump's Cyber Strategy for America.' Notably, it is the first U.S. cybersecurity strategy to explicitly mention cryptocurrency and blockchain technology, emphasizing the need for their protection and security.

"Securing American innovation and protecting our national intellectual advantage will be paramount. We will build secure technologies and supply chains that protect user privacy from design to deployment, including supporting the security of cryptocurrencies and blockchain technologies. We will promote the adoption of post-quantum cryptography and secure quantum computing," - set out in this cyber strategy.
